+(cl-defgeneric seq-find (pred seq &optional default)
+ "Return the first element for which (PRED element) is non-nil in SEQ.
+If no element is found, return DEFAULT.
+
+Note that `seq-find' has an ambiguity if the found element is
+identical to DEFAULT, as it cannot be known if an element was
+found or not."
+ (catch 'seq--break
+ (seq-doseq (elt seq)
+ (when (funcall pred elt)
+ (throw 'seq--break elt)))
+ default))
